Test targets run with `-n auto`, which makes `pytest-benchmark` (present via `langchain-tests`) auto-disable itself and emit a `PytestBenchmarkWarning` once per xdist worker. Passing `--benchmark-disable` turns the plugin off explicitly so the warning never fires, matching what `core` and `langchain_v1` already do. ## Changes - Add `--benchmark-disable` to the `-n auto` test targets across `langchain` (unit) and 14 partner packages' integration targets: `anthropic`, `chroma`, `deepseek`, `exa`, `fireworks`, `groq`, `huggingface`, `mistralai`, `nomic`, `ollama`, `openai`, `openrouter`, `qdrant`, `xai`. - Deliberately excluded `text-splitters` and `model-profiles`: their `test` group doesn't install `pytest-benchmark`, so the flag would fail with `unrecognized arguments`. Verified by importing the plugin under each package's actual dependency group before editing.

Quick Install
pip install langchain-huggingface
Note: The base install does not include
sentence-transformersortransformers. If you plan to useHuggingFaceEmbeddingsorHuggingFacePipelinefor local inference, install the[full]extra which includessentence-transformers>=5.2.0andtransformers>=5.0.0:pip install langchain-huggingface[full]Migrating from
langchain-community? Note thatlangchain-communityacceptedsentence-transformers>=2.2.0, butlangchain-huggingface[full]requires>=5.2.0. If your project pins an older version, upgrade it:pip install "sentence-transformers>=5.2.0"
🤔 What is this?
This package contains the LangChain integrations for Hugging Face related classes.
